Transaction 8037a36be827b0443ed56a036e5ab4f465a59965776705f68701939016316914

1 Input
2 Outputs
  • 8037a36be827b0443ed56a036e5ab4f465a59965776705f68701939016316914:0
  • value  101564
    address  3QJ9zrQDfNakkLgRqheF7mm4txSm73zKQU
  • 8037a36be827b0443ed56a036e5ab4f465a59965776705f68701939016316914:1
  • value  72321
    address  15SjqPRr9rWc9gndSdGBLgpP1UfNaHMq8a